The New World of Who was the episode of Doctor Who Confidential broadcast in conjunction with Love & Monsters.

Aspects of production covered

  • The plotting of Love & Monsters, to accommodate for the need to have a 'Doctor-lite' story.
  • The filming of the scene to tie-in with the Auton invasion seen in Rose.
  • Prosthetics work for the Abzorbaloff.

Additional topics covered

  • The Blue Peter competition from which the concept of the Abzorbaloff came.
  • Shooting the interactive Attack of the Graske mini-episode.

Home video releases

The "Cut Down" version of the episode is available on the Doctor Who: The Complete Second Series DVD box set.
